The Case for Sweden

6 reasons our counsellors weigh in on Sweden

01

Two Universities Inside the Global Top 90

Lund University (#71) and KTH Royal Institute of Technology (#82) both sit inside the QS World Top 90 (2027) — genuine global prestige.

02

The Largest English-Taught Catalogue in This List

Sweden offers 950+ English-taught master's programs across 39 universities — one of the broadest selections of any non-English-speaking country.

03

A Straightforward 12-Month Work Window

Graduates get a 12-month residence permit to search for work or start a business after finishing their degree — with an 18-month option now available specifically for research/doctoral graduates from June 2026.

04

A Genuine European Tech Hub

Home to Spotify, Klarna, and a dense Stockholm startup ecosystem — direct relevance for engineering and business graduates.

05

A High Quality of Life

Sweden consistently ranks among the world's safest, most equal, and best-governed countries.

06

A Modest but Real Indian Community

An estimated 2,500+ Indian students currently study in Sweden — still a small cohort relative to the UK or Germany, but growing.
